    Hello from Switzerland

    Hi, sure. Until end of 2020 rules are relatively simple: for drones 0,5-30 kg visual flight only, unlimited altitude, don’t fly over groups of over 24 people (and stay at least 100 mt away). There are restrictions: NFZ within 5km radius from airports, 150m max altitude in CTRs, no fly in some...
